2022 CLASSES: Holiday Parties (All Ages)

2008 mystery party_1.jpg
Class Description
We will make crafts, play games, eat wonderful holiday snacks, and enjoy each others' company.

October – Halloween Party
December – Christmas party
February – Valentines Party
April – Easter party

Meet The Teacher

Hello! I'm Susan Bacon, director of Franklin School. I have a B.S. in Education with a minor in Gifted Education. I'm a state certified teacher with 5 years public school teaching experience and 35 years of working with students. Through private tutoring, teaching homeschool classes, and working with homeschooling families I have found that my greatest joy in life is helping students find their own unique way of learning.


After working as a cover school coordinator for 5 years I founded Franklin School. I saw a need to provide families with a more creative learning experience with a larger variety of activities. As director of Franklin School these past 20 years I have offered homeschooling families curriculum assistance, transcripts, a lending library, activities, classes, field trips, parent workshops, and many other homeschooling amenities. 

​

As a certified and very experienced teacher my goal is to assist parents by offering support in all areas of homeschooling and to help enrich each student’s educational adventure by offering a variety of classes.
